to care
01
关心, 在乎
to consider something or someone important and to have a feeling of worry or concern toward them
Intransitive: to care about sb/sth
例子
He cares about his job and always gives his best.
他关心自己的工作,总是尽力而为。
02
照顾, 关心
to attend to the needs, safety, and happiness of someone or something
Intransitive: to care for sb/sth
例子
They cared for their grandparents during their final years.
他们在祖父母的最后几年里照顾他们。
03
偏爱, 想要
to prefer or desire to do something over other options
Transitive: to care to do sth
例子
They care to read books in their free time instead of watching television.
他们更喜欢在空闲时间读书而不是看电视。
04
关心, 在意
to feel worry, interest, or regard for something or someone
Transitive
例子
She does n’t care who wins the game, as long as it ’s a fair match.
她不在乎谁赢了比赛,只要这是一场公平的比赛。
Care
01
照顾、关注
the act of providing treatment and paying attention to the physical and emotional needs of someone or something
例子
The elderly residents of the nursing home received compassionate care from the dedicated staff members.
养老院的老年居民从敬业的工作人员那里得到了富有同情心的照顾。
02
谨慎, 小心
judiciousness in avoiding harm or danger
03
护理, 维护
activity involved in maintaining something in good working order
04
照顾, 注意
attention and management implying responsibility for safety
05
关心, 忧虑
a cause for feeling concern
06
忧虑, 担心
an anxious feeling
